Bathroom Deep Cleaning in Goa
Descaling, grout and sanitising
Ten years of Goan bathrooms has taught us exactly where the line sits, and it is drawn by the water. Mains supply and well water are both kind — bathrooms running on either clean up much as you would expect. Borewell and tanker water are another matter entirely. The scale they leave does not behave like ordinary limescale: heavy-duty descalers that would strip it anywhere else barely make an impression, and neither does acid.
On flat surfaces we can still win. Ceramic tile, glass, chrome and steel take a proper descale and come back. Where it gets genuinely difficult is toughened glass and textured surfaces — a shower screen, an anti-slip floor tile, a textured basin — because the deposit keys into the texture, or into the surface of the glass itself. On those, prevention beats cure by a wide margin. A squeegee after each shower and a dry screen will save you from ever needing us for it.
Everything short of that, we bring back. Grout gone yellow year on year, taps and shower roses furred solid, the film across the glass — descaled with the product matched to the surface.
Every bathroom deep cleaning job covers this as standard
Every home is different. If there is something particular you would like looked at, just mention it when you book and we will work it into the plan.
- Tile and grout descaling and deep scrubbing
- Taps, showers and fittings descaled and polished
- Shower glass hard-water film removal
- WC, basin and drains sanitised
- Mirrors, cabinets and fixtures
- Exhaust fans and ventilation grilles

Bathroom Deep Cleaning questions
Why will the scale in my house not come off, even with strong descalers?
Check what the house runs on. Mains supply and well water never give this trouble — it is borewell and tanker water that do. The mineral load in them leaves a deposit that behaves nothing like ordinary limescale: standard descalers make little impression on it, and acid does not do much either. On flat ceramic, glass and metal we can still get it off. On toughened glass and textured surfaces it becomes very difficult, which is why we would rather help you stop it forming than promise to remove it later.
Can you remove hard water stains from shower glass?
Usually, yes — light and moderate scaling comes off completely. Toughened glass is the hard case: where hard water has been left on it for years the deposit has bonded into the surface itself, and no amount of descaling shifts that.
How do I stop hard water scale coming back?
If the budget allows it, a good water softener is the real answer — treat the water and there is nothing left behind to scrub off later. Short of that, keep surfaces dry: a squeegee over the shower screen after each use, a cloth over the taps, and enough ventilation that the room is not permanently damp. It sounds almost too simple, but on borewell or tanker water it is the most effective thing you can do, and far more so than any service we could sell you.
We are building on borewell water. What should we specify?
Choose the fittings and finishes with the water in mind, while the bathroom is still being designed. Flat ceramic, chrome and steel all descale well and keep coming back. Textured surfaces and toughened glass are the ones that are very hard to recover once the deposit has keyed into them, so an anti-slip floor tile or a toughened shower screen is worth thinking twice about if you know what will be running through the pipes.
Will yellowed grout actually come back to white?
Deep cleaning lifts most discolouration. Grout that has broken down or been stained through needs regrouting, which is a different trade — we will say so rather than sell you a clean that cannot deliver.
